kedifa: Implement logging

As Kedifa is long running process, it has to be diagnosed post-mortem.
Printing out information is not reliable in this case, so switch to log.

Logging gives:

 * controllable retention of information
 * more details
 * possibility to run quietly on system which do not catch process output

Reopening the logs after its rotation has been solved with WatchedFileHandler,
